Carrier Global Corporation is an industrial company that provides solutions for heating, cooling, and ventilation of residential and commercial spaces. The company operates through four main segments: Climate Solutions Americas, Climate Solutions Europe, Climate Solutions Asia Pacific, Middle East & Africa, and Climate Solutions Transportation, offering products and services under various brands including Carrier, Viessmann, Toshiba, and Carrier Transicold. It also supplies transport refrigeration systems, aftermarket components, maintenance services, and digital monitoring solutions.

How is Carrier Global Corporation analysed technically?
Technical analysis of Carrier Global Corporation is based on price charts and indicators such as moving averages, RSI and MACD, to observe trend, momentum and volatility across different time horizons.
Which timeframes are used for Carrier Global Corporation?
The daily and weekly charts are typically used for medium-to-long-term trends, while intraday charts (for example 1-hour or 15-minute) are used for short-term movements.
What are Elliott Waves applied to Carrier Global Corporation?
Elliott Wave theory describes price moves as sequences of impulsive and corrective waves; applied to Carrier Global Corporation it helps frame the technical structure of the historical chart and is not a forecast.
